Agartala: According to an official release, three people were arrested by Assam Rifles and heroin valued at Rs 9.51 lakh was retrieved from them in Aizawl as part of a combined operation with the Mizoram Special Narcotics CID.

The discovery was made in an operation that took place on Friday. The arrested individuals are reported to be residents of Mizoram have been identified as 24-year-old Bikash Gharti , 29-year-old Ngurthanzami and 37-year-old Lalramthara.

The accused were carrying the contraband in a white polythene bag. The Special Narcotics CID (Crime), Police Station, Aizawl, Mizoram, received the full consignment and the arrested suspects for additional legal proceedings.

In a separate operation, massive areas of ganja crop spanning 16.2 hectares in the general region of the Boxanagar Forest Range under the Sonamura subdivision here in Mizoram were burnt on Friday by Assam Rifles in collaboration with the Police and Tripura Forest Service.

Assam Rifles claimed in its press release on Thursday that 16,500 cannabis plants, worth about Rs 70 lakh, were eradicated as a result of the operation.

According to a news release, earlier this week, Assam Rifles seized 10,320 kg of illicit Areca Nuts valued at around Rs 72.24 lakhs in the general area of Zote, Champhai district, Mizoram.

A combined team of Assam Rifles and representatives of the Customs Preventive Force, Champhai, conducted the operation on January 4.
